Hamilton taxpayers are now facing a 1.2% increase.
That amounts to about 42 dollars for the average homeowner.
Amongst all Ontario municipalities that have approved their 2012 budgets, it would be the smallest increase in the province, lower than Windsor's 1.4% increase.
General Manager of Finance Rob Rossini suggests they are close to a final number.
He notes that politicians would have to find another 10 million dollars in savings to get to zero, something that is "not really possible from what I'm looking at without impacting services".
Another budget meeting is scheduled for Tuesday at City Hall.
